Strawberry Cake in a Jar

Strawberry cake in a jar is a layered, portable dessert made with soft cake, fresh strawberries, and creamy frosting. This strawberry cake in a jar is perfect for parties, gifts, or an easy make-ahead treat.
Prep Time 20 minutes mins
Chill Time 2 hours hrs
Total Time 2 hours hrs 20 minutes mins
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
- For the Cake:
- 2 cups vanilla or strawberry cake cubed, homemade or store-bought
- For the Layers:
- 1 1/2 cups fresh strawberries sliced
- 1 1/2 cups whipped cream or frosting buttercream or cream cheese
- Optional Add-Ins:
- 1/4 cup strawberry jam or sauce
- 1/4 cup chocolate chips
- 1/4 cup crushed cookies
Prepare cake and cut into small cubes.
Wash, hull, and slice strawberries.
Add a layer of cake cubes to the bottom of each jar.
Spoon a layer of whipped cream or frosting over the cake.
Add a layer of sliced strawberries.
Repeat layers until jars are filled.
Top with extra cream and strawberries.
Chill in the fridge for 1–2 hours before serving (optional).

Use moist cake for best texture.

Do not overfill jars to keep layers neat.

Add a bit of strawberry sauce for extra flavor.

Best enjoyed within 1–2 days.

Store in fridge up to 3 days.
